It's the summer of 1971, and Andy Hanson, a junior high student, lives a quiet, uneventful life in the New York City borough of Staten Island. Now, however, he must confront what was once a simple assumption: who is his friend? A chance encounter with a student-a young man Andy once wrote off as 'a waste of life'-provokes the youngster onto a tumultuous journey.
As if the turmoil confronting Andy regarding who he believed were his friends and the social implications that this student has thrust upon him were not enough, a serial killer of young boys lurks in the shadows, waiting for his next opportunity.
The ruthless killer's activities drift along a path that will eventually cross the carefree pre-teen exploits of Andy and his friends. What remains of Andy's friendships and his friends at the story's end will prove how strong each was from the beginning.
